Question 12

A uniform wooden plank, of mass mmm kg and length 100 cm, rests horizontally on a flat roof. One end of the plank, DDD, extends 30 cm beyond the edge of the roof, CCC.

a.

The plank is in equilibrium and on the point of tilting about CCC when a tool kit of mass 0.8 kg is placed at the midpoint of the overhanging section CDCDCD. Show that m=0.6m = 0.6m=0.6.

[3]
b.

The tool kit is removed. A number, nnn, of identical small weights, each of mass 0.07 kg, are hung from the plank at a distance of 5 cm from DDD. Find the maximum value of nnn such that the plank remains horizontal.

[3]
c.

State one assumption you have made about the plank.

[1]
